Output 83dafa12fc321b765319dddbe6c288158b9a9c61f8f11b037c7e49b97c20ff3e:0

value
254226
script pubkey
OP_0 OP_PUSHBYTES_20 762a0b12e06f34a0299c018880a054a648bd2bf9
address
bc1qwc4qkyhqdu62q2vuqxygpgz55eyt62lenglsvq
transaction
83dafa12fc321b765319dddbe6c288158b9a9c61f8f11b037c7e49b97c20ff3e
spent
true